High-paying medical assistant jobs in Bronx
Medical Assistants support healthcare professionals by performing clinical and administrative tasks. They manage patient records and conduct basic tests. Strong organizational skills are essential.
The 484 medical assistant jobs listed below pay well, with salaries between $36,383 and $148,741 per year. Patient Services Representative, Clinic Coordinator and Medical Office Assistant are among the most popular high-paying roles in Bronx, NY.

Clinical Documentation Specialist
Review job description
Please refer to the employers job description for complete details.
Clinical Documentation Specialists ensure the accuracy and completeness of clinical documentation to support quality care and compliance. Essential skills include analytical thinking, knowledge of clinical terminology, and attention to detail.
The top companies hiring Clinical Documentation Specialist in Bronx, NY are BronxCare Health System (3 jobs), WCS Healthcare Partners (1 job), and Workmen's Circle Nursing and Rehabilitation Center (1 job).
Currently, 21% of job openings offer remote or hybrid positions and 0% of job openings are part-time roles.

Clinic Coordinator
Review job description
Please refer to the employers job description for complete details.
Clinic coordinators manage daily operations, schedule appointments, coordinate patient care services and collaborate with medical staff to ensure efficient clinic functioning. Essential skills for this role include organization, proficiency in healthcare systems and teamwork.
The top companies hiring Clinic Coordinator in Bronx, NY are Geel Community Services (2 jobs), City University of New York (1 job), and The Institute for Family Health (1 job).
Clinic Coordinator jobs take 46 days on average from job posting to starting date. Currently, 7% of job openings are part-time roles.

Patient Advocate
Review job description
Please refer to the employers job description for complete details.
Patient advocates guide patients through the healthcare system, address concerns, ensure needs are met and facilitate communication between patients and providers. Key traits for this role include empathy, strong communication skills and knowledge of healthcare regulations.
The top companies hiring Patient Advocate in Bronx, NY are Essen Health Care (2 jobs), Services For The Underserved (1 job), and Callen-Lorde (1 job).
Patient Advocate jobs take 21 days on average from job posting to starting date. Currently, 14% of job openings are part-time roles.

Medical Scribe
Review job description
Please refer to the employers job description for complete details.
Medical scribes assist healthcare providers by documenting patient encounters, maintaining accurate medical records and managing documentation tasks. Accuracy and strong communication skills are essential for this role, along with understanding medical terminology and workflow.
The top companies hiring Medical Scribe in Bronx, NY are Oak Street Health, part of CVS Health (5 jobs), USA Clinics Group (1 job), and CityMD (1 job).
Medical Scribe jobs take 120 days on average from job posting to starting date. Currently, 34% of job openings are part-time roles.
